Trail 12 Pozo Nuevo

LAYOUT Linear
DIFFICULTY Medium-low

LENGTH 1,7 km

DURATION 50 min

OBSERVATIONS

It runs along the old road of a mining railway and brings us to the remains of the Pozo Nuevo mine.

The first section of this trail runs along an old mining railroad track between pine trees and other species of Mediterranean forest vegetation: holm oaks, cork oaks and thickets of rockrose, rosemary, lavender and marjoram.
Upon reaching the remains of the mine, known as Pozo Nuevo, we see buildings and infrastructure of the old mine, which stopped working in 1963 and has a depth of 570m.
From the Viewpoint we can see a panoramic view of the Grande River Valley and the El Puntal mountain massif
Back, we descend through a firewall from which we see the town of El Centenillo and ruins of old mines. Finally we crossed an old railway tunnel.
